On 2020-03-24 11:05, Lukasz wrote: > Hallo, > > I replaced one disk in my raidz1 pool, after that new one was resilvered > but the entire pool is still in degraded state. In earlier FreeBSD > versions zpool always returned to online state. Am I missing something > or have I to do something additional? > > # zpool status > pool: mypool > state: DEGRADED > status: One or more devices has experienced an error resulting in data > corruption. Applications may be affected. > action: Restore the file in question if possible. Otherwise restore the > entire pool from backup. > see: http://illumos.org/msg/ZFS-8000-8A > scan: resilvered 180G in 0 days 16:00:55 with 2 errors on Sun Mar 22 > 05:18:46 2020 > config: > > NAME STATE READ WRITE CKSUM > mypool DEGRADED 0 0 2 > raidz1-0 DEGRADED 0 0 4 > diskid/DISK-WD-WMC1F0521131 ONLINE 0 0 0 > replacing-1 DEGRADED 0 0 0 > 15838717335844820448 UNAVAIL 0 0 0 was > /dev/diskid/DISK-WD-WCC130964640 > diskid/DISK-K4JG5D2B ONLINE 0 0 0 > ada6 ONLINE 0 0 0 > ada1 ONLINE 0 0 0 > diskid/DISK-WD-WCC130650055 ONLINE 0 0 0 > > errors: 1 data errors, use '-v' for a list > > Regards, > Lukasz Please run the following commands and paste the console session into a reply: # freebsd-version ; uname -a # zpool status -v mypool So, you had 5 drives in RAIDZ1, one died, you removed the failed drive, you installed a replacement drive, and you issued a 'zpool replace' command? Have you disabled services that use datasets in that pool? Have you set the readonly property on those datasets? Do you have a backup? David
